EnBW office building

Energy generation and comfort smartly integrated

The new headquarters of Netze BW GmbH in Altbach is a building that combines sustainable construction and architectural clarity into a holistic concept. As the new front building of an existing warehouse, the two-storey structure visibly marks the site in the public space and signals the ongoing development of the company’s infrastructure. At the same time, it represents the start of the energy efficiency upgrades for the entire area.

Monolithic architecture with an active building envelope

The new building is a clean structure with precise proportions. Its dark façade gives it a calm yet striking presence. Through its reflective surfaces, the building engages in a constant dialogue with its surroundings. The sky, vegetation and lighting conditions are reflected, causing the building to look different depending on the time of day. The result is a structure that, despite its clean geometry, exudes a surprising sense of lightness. A key feature of the project is the fusion of architecture and energy generation. Building-integrated photovoltaic (BIPV) modules from Schüco were installed on the south- and east-facing façade surfaces. The modules are fully integrated into the building envelope and blend seamlessly into the uniform appearance. With an installed capacity of approximately 40 kWp, the system generates a large amount of the electricity needed directly on-site and enables a self-sufficiency rate of approximately 73 percent. On the remaining sides of the façade, the design is continued with opaque façade units, creating a consistent architectural appearance.

Schüco Perfect as an integrated system solution

The window openings were constructed using the Schüco AWS 75.SI Perfect 190 system. The administrative building in Altbach is therefore one of the early reference projects to feature this new system solution in commercial construction. In keeping with the holistic design approach for the building, Schüco Perfect views the building opening not as the sum of individual components, but as an integrated system.

Windows, sun shading, window sills and other functional components are assembled in the workshop into a technically integrated unit. This reduces the number of interfaces and simplifies planning, fabrication and installation. At the same time, the system supports the architectural concept of the construction. The integration of functional components allows for a clean and precise façade design without additional attachments or visible transitions. Slim profile face widths and large glass areas create bright workspaces, whilst the integrated sun shading helps keep areas cool in the summer.

User comfort and a healthy indoor environment

The high standards set for the building envelope are continued throughout the interior. The workspaces have been designed to provide a comfortable and healthy environment for users. Generous window areas allow for an abundance of natural light and create visual connections to the surroundings. The integrated sun shading systems also ensure glare-free workspaces and a comfortable indoor climate. The structure is based on load-bearing cross-laminated timber (CLT) walls and prefabricated CLT floor units with integrated acoustic panels, which are supplemented by acoustically decoupled interior wall shells. Clay panels with breathable lime plaster regulate temperature and humidity, and help to create a comfortable indoor climate. Acoustically optimised wall structures complement the design and guarantee a quiet work environment despite the proximity to traffic infrastructure.

Sustainability as a holistic concept

During the planning process, sustainability was not reduced to individual measures but understood as an overarching guiding principle. The new building is based on a prefabricated timber construction method that incorporates renewable raw materials and adheres to the principles of circular material use. Many components were selected so that they can be sorted by type and recycled at the end of their life cycle. The combination of building-integrated photovoltaics, smart building automation, eco-friendly insulation materials and exterior sun shading lays the foundation for energy-efficient operation of the building. The concept is completed by a landscaped retention roof, which collects rainwater, improves the microclimate and creates additional habitats for plants and insects.

BIPV

Schüco Building Integrated Photovoltaics

Energeticamente eficiente, uma alternativa para a conservação de recursos nas unidades de recheio. São perfeitos para obra nova e projetos de renovação energeticamente eficientes

Sistemas fotovoltaicos integrados (BIPV) nos sistemas Schüco de janelas e fachadas, assim como as claraboias usam a envolvente do edifício para a geração de electricidade solar. Isto transforma aos edifícios equipados com módulos BIPV de consumidores de energia em produtores de energia. Os módulos constroem-se à medida segundo as especificações dos arquitetos com um design individual em termos de forma, cor e estrutura visual.
